Matenrou Opera



Matenrou Opera (摩天楼オペラ lit. "Skyscraper Opera"?) is a Japanese visual kei metal band. The band was formed in 2007 by Sono and Yuu who were previously the vocalist and drummer of Jeniva. Their first maxi-single was on the Office A to Z label. "Alkaloid Showcase" was released on May 4, the same day as their first concert, it sold out before the concert began.
In late 2007, guitarist Mika and female keyboardist Karen left the band, they were replaced by guitarist Anzi (ex-Masterpiece) and male keyboardist Ayame (ex-Ry:dia) respectively.
In 2008, after joining the label Sherow Artist Society, the single "Ruri Iro de Egaku Niji" reached number 11 on the Oricon Indies Chart; the EP Giliareached number 7 and was also released in Europe. Matenrou Opera toured through Europe with Versailles from the end of March to the beginning of April 2008.
In late 2009, Matenrou Opera shared a national tour of Japan with Deluhi.
Matenrou Opera covered X Japan's song "Kurenai" for the compilation Crush! -90's V-Rock Best Hit Cover Songs-. The album was released on January 26, 2011 and features current visual kei bands covering songs from bands that were important to the '90s visual kei movement.

Members

  • Sono – vocals
  • Anzi – guitar
  • Ayame – keyboards, keytar
  • Yo – bass 
  • Yuu – drums

Former members

  • Mika – guitar
  • Karen - keyboards, keytar

Discography

Albums & EPs

  • Gilia (May 14, 2008)
  • Anomie (June 24, 2009)
  • Abyss (December 22, 2010)
  • Justice (March 7, 2012)

Singles

  • "Alkaloid Showcase" (May 4, 2007)
  • "Sara" (live-distributed only, October 30, 2007)
  • "Ruri iro de egaku niji" (瑠璃色で描く虹, March 5, 2008)
  • "Spectacular" (September 24, 2008)
  • "Last Scene" (December 17, 2008)
  • "Acedia" (March 25, 2009)
  • "Eternal Symphony" (live-distributed only, July 23, 2009)
  • "Murder Scope" (December 16, 2009)
  • "R" (live-distributed only, February 24, 2010)
  • "「Genesis/R」" (May 17, 2010)
  • "Helios" (July 6, 2011)
  • "Otoshiana no Soko wa Konna Sekai" (October 19, 2011)
